Output cc63bc40d540079089c771c3c382dfffc76ddd3552fd5664caa732622980e474:19

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c22f360309573b566fd2c983a7852063e8538aa0 OP_EQUAL
address
3KPma31jrMgMpLrC1ZQqC2jBYwWm6MHz6L
transaction
cc63bc40d540079089c771c3c382dfffc76ddd3552fd5664caa732622980e474
confirmations
496490
spent
true